
Scarlett Johansson on 2000s Hollywood: Harsh Looks-Driven Casting, but Change Is Coming
Scarlett Johansson says the early 2000s were a harsh time for young actresses, with looks often dictating roles and women being pigeonholed as bombshells or the other woman; she found refuge in New York theater, learned to wait for the right roles, and notes that by 2026 there are more empowering opportunities for women in film.
